Vous êtes sur la page 1sur 54

Modèle Conceptuel des

Données

Problématique

Les objets

Les relations

Exemple

Cardinalités

Règles de simplification

Règles de construction

Normalisation
Problématique
SUPERMARCHE
boite de 6
7DH sardines à
3D l'huile d'olive
H petit mousse
SUPERMARCHE

SAVON
SUPERMARCHE
Problématique
SUPERMARCHE
7DH boite de 6
sardines à
3D
H l'huile d'olive
petit mousse
DH
SUPERMARCHE 6.5

0.6 DH
SAVON
DH
SUPERMARCHE 2.5
Modèle Conceptuel des
Données

Problématique

Les objets

Les relations

Exemple

Cardinalités

Règles de simplification

Règles de construction

Normalisation
Les objets

Objet :
 Entité porteuse de propriétés qui est identifiée par
l'organisme

 Propriété :
 Information élémentaire dépendante d'un objet ou d'une
association d'objets

 Identifiant :
 Propriété, ou composition de propriétés, qui permet
l'identification exacte d'une occurence
Les objets
Définition: Attribut, propriété
Une propriété est un élément d’une entité, et d’une
seule :
 décrit la mémorisation d’une
information élémentaire,
 a un nom unique,
 permet de mémoriser une valeur,
 doit avoir un sens (donc une valeur)
pour chacune des occurrences de la
composante

 Domaine de valeurs.
Définition: Attribut, propriété
Les objets
Mnémonique
Identifiant
Propriété 1
Propriété 2
.........
Propriété n

Nombre fini
et défini de
propriétés
Les objets
Mnémonique
Identifiant
Propriété 1
Propriété 2
.........
Propriété n
Les objets
Mnémonique
Identifiant
Propriété 1
Propriété 2
.........
Propriété n
Définition: Identifiant
L’identifiant de l’entité est une propriété qui ne peut
pas prendre deux fois la même valeur dans deux
occurrences de l’entité.
Exemples:
• CIN ( Alphanumérique);
•code barre d’un produit;
•ISBN d’un livre ( 13 chiffres + 1 lettre)

identifiant ( obligatoire ): C’est


l’identifiant qui fait l’entité.
Définition: Identifiant
Définition: Mise en place d’une entité
 Repérer tout objet concret ou abstrait , tout individu
ayant une existence propre et conforme aux besoins
de gestion de l’organisation.
 Attribuer à chaque entité son identifiant et ses
propriétés.
Définition: Occurrence
 Pour une valeur de l’identifiant, on a une valeur
de chacune des propriétés.
 Deux occurrences de l’entité ne peuvent avoir
la même valeur d’identifiant.
Modèle Conceptuel des
Données

Problématique

Les objets

Les relations

Exemple

Cardinalités

Règles de simplification

Règles de construction

Normalisation
Les relations
Entité qui peut être porteuse de propriétés
Identifiée par la composition des
identifiants

Relation

Association perçue entre objets de


l'univers étudié
Les relations A B

AR B
Définition: Représentation
d’association
Les relations
 Relation binaire réflexive (1/2)

Personne
N° SS A pour mère
Nom
Les relations
 Relation binaire réflexive (2/2)

Objet
Relation
ID
PR1
P1
....
...
PRn
Pn
Les relations

Magasin Produit
Nom Vendre Code
adresse Prix de vente désignation
ville packaging
Les relations
 Relation binaire (2/2)

Objet 1 Objet 2
Relation
ID1 ID2
P11 PR1 P21
.... .... ....
P1n PRn P2n
Les relations
 Relation n-aire (1/2)

Période
Code
date début
date fin
Magasin Produit
Nom Vendre Code
adresse Prix de vente désignation
ville packaging
Les relations
 Relation n-aire (2/2)

Objet 3
ID3
P31
....
P3n
Objet 1 Objet 2
Relation
ID1 ID2
P11 PR1 P21
.... .... ....
P1n PRn P2n
•Une association ternaire peut se
représenter par une combinaison
d’associations binaires
Les relations
 Résumé

Relation binaire réflexive

Relation binaire

Relation ternaire
Modèle Conceptuel des
Données

Problématique

Les objets

Les relations

Exemple

Cardinalités

Règles de simplification

Règles de construction

Normalisation
Exemple

es
ett
ec
R
Exemple
 Modélisation du S.I. lié à un livre de recettes

sel

beurre
Une recette =
eau

ingrédient
Exemple

Un ingrédient
peut en
remplacer un
autre
Exemple

Recette Ingrédient
nom recette Se compose de Nom ingred
Quantité

Remplacé par
Exemple

Erreur, un ingrédient peut en remplacer


un autre dans une recette déterminée
Exemple

Recette Ingrédient
nom recette Se compose de Nom ingred
Quantité

Remplacé par
Modèle Conceptuel des
Données

Problématique

Les objets

Les relations

Exemple

Cardinalités

Règles de simplification

Règles de construction

Normalisation
Cardinalités
 Définition
 Nombre minimum et nombre maximum d'occurrences de
la relation au départ d'une occurrence de l'ensemble.

0 1 2 3 n

aucune plusieurs

doit exister
Cardinalités
 Relation 1,1 - 0,1

A B
Cardinalités

Relation 0,n - 0,1
A B
Parent Enfant

 Appelée : Relation hiérarchique


Cardinalités

Relation 0,n - 0,n
A B

 Appelée : Relation N-P


Cardinalités
Personne 1,1
N° SS A pour mère
Nom
0,n


correct conceptuellement
 non initialisable
Cardinalités
Personne 0,1
N° SS A pour mère
Nom
0,n


correct conceptuellement
 initialisable
Cardinalités

Magasin Produit
Nom 0,n Vendre 0,n Code
adresse Prix de vente désignation
ville packaging
Cardinalités

Magasin Produit
Nom 0,n Vendre 0,n Code
adresse Prix de vente désignation
ville packaging
Cardinalités

Magasin Produit
Nom 0,n Vendre 0,1 Code
adresse Prix de vente désignation
ville packaging
Prix de vente
Cardinalités

Magasin Produit
Nom 0,n Vendre 0,1 Code
adresse désignation
ville packaging
Prix de vente

 Une relation hiérarchique ne peut être porteuse


de propriétés
Cardinalités
Période
Code
date début
date fin
0,n
Magasin Produit
Nom 0,n Vendre 0,n Code
adresse Prix de vente désignation
ville packaging
Cardinalités
 Gestion des Historiques
magasin
Code
.....
Chiffre affaire

Magasin Mois
Code 0,n Réaliser C.A. 0,n mois
C.A.
Cardinalités
Magasin Rayon
Code Code

0,n 0,n

Réaliser C.A.
C.A.
0,n
Mois
mois
Modèle Conceptuel des
Données

Problématique

Les objets

Les relations

Exemple

Cardinalités

Règles de simplification

Règles de construction

Normalisation
Règles de simplification
Magasin Superette
Code magasin 1,1 1,1 Code superette
nbre personne surface vente

Synonyme

Magasin
Code magasin
nbre personne
surface vente
Règles de simplification
Contrat
n° Contrat :
entre

et

il a

pour pour
Règles de simplification
Client Fournisseur
Code Code
nom nom
solvabilité
0,n 0,n

Souscrire

1,1
Contrat
Code contrat
montant HT
date
Règles de simplification
Client Fournisseur
Code Code
nom nom
solvabilité
0,n 0,n
0,n 0,n
Souscrire
CIF CIF
1,1
Contrat
Code contrat
1,1 montant HT 1,1
date
Règles de simplification
Client Fournisseur
Code Code
nom nom
solvabilité
0,n 0,n

CIF CIF

Contrat
Code contrat
1,1 montant HT 1,1
date

Vous aimerez peut-être aussi